Seared Salmon Fillet with Roasted Asparagus and Cauliflower Mash
Pan-seared salmon served over creamy cauliflower mash with oven-roasted asparagus, finished with a squeeze of lemon and fresh dill for a bright, zesty finish.
INGREDIENTS
6.2 oz Salmon Fillet
1.5 cups Cauliflower florets
1 cup Asparagus spears
1.5 ts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il
0.5 tsp Garlic powder
1 tbsp Lemon juice
Sea salt and black pepper to taste
PREPARATION
Preheat your oven to 400°F and line a small baking sheet with parchment paper.
Trim the woody ends off the asparagus and toss with 0.5 teaspoon of olive oil, salt, and pepper on the baking sheet.
Roast the asparagus for 12-15 minutes until tender and slightly charred.
While asparagus roasts, steam the cauliflower florets until very soft, about 8-10 minutes.
Drain the cauliflower well and place in a food processor with 0.5 teaspoon of olive oil, garlic powder, and salt; blend until smooth and creamy.
Season the salmon fillet with salt and pepper.
Heat the remaining 0.5 teaspoon of olive oil in a non-stick skillet over medium-high heat.
Place the salmon in the pan skin-side down and sear for 4-5 minutes until the skin is crisp.
Flip the salmon and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until cooked to your desired level of doneness.
Spoon the cauliflower mash onto a plate, top with the seared salmon, and serve alongside the roasted asparagus with a drizzle of fresh lemon juice.
